Legacy safety systems treat every human presence as a hard stop, forcing a compromise between safety and throughput. A software-defined safety layer that upgrades your existing fleet with Dynamic Intelligence.
Rigid safety zones cause a 20%+ drop in throughput by forcing unnecessary stops when humans are nearby.
Fences and mats lock your operations into a fixed layout and a simple change becomes costly downtime.
Caging robots isolates them from humans and kills cobot applications.
Certification, collaboration, fault response, and a pilot program built for your floor plan
Functional and AI Safety certified, including ISO 13849-1 (Cat 3/PL d), ISO 61508 (SIL 3), and ISO 22440
Aligned with ISO 10218 guidelines for safe human-robot interaction to share workspaces without static physical guards
Rapid hazard mitigation with a validated fault-detection interval under 50 ms
